Good point that is. Isn't it harder now to get a European manager or am I wrong.
Apparently they've got to have been managing in a top European league for 36 months in the last 5 years (or one continuous 24-month stint). Very difficult requirement to meet (although I think Maurice Steijn's time at VVV-Venlo might qualify him?).
